Taking action on climate requires a supportive constituency. Research shows there’s a gap between wanting to see more action from government, and supporting actions that governments identify as most effective. This session introduces the Climate Literacy Tool, a resource designed to improve public understanding of climate solutions. The session will feature a high-level presentation on priorities for action in the Metro Vancouver region, and then introduce and explore the Climate Literacy online learning tool. The majority of your time will be spent workshopping the tool, exploring practical applications, and opportunities for collaboration. This aims to equip participants with valuable knowledge and a new tool to advance climate literacy in their own networks.
